We disassemble the future model "bone by bone"
After you have decided on the volumetric design of the sofa (two- or three-seater, in what style interpretation it should be made), you need to think about what the product will consist of.
- The furniture skeleton called "frame" is the invisible basis of the product, providing its load-bearing capacity. Whether it will be made of solid wood, metal or a combination of beams and chipboard is up to you.

a) Remember that elitism wood gives not only unique aesthetic indicators, but also excellent strength parameters (for example, mahogany). Oak, ash, beech and walnut are domestic analogues of good quality wood, and birch, cherry and pine allow you to save more. It is very important to use raw materials that are sufficiently dried before processing (10%, and even better if 8%). Bolted connections will provide reliable, non-creaky fixation of the joints, good glue will perfectly fasten the mating parts.
b) Metal frame gives a touch of modernity and unusual execution. A large selection of profile material, many color options contribute to the desired correspondence of the frame to the buyer's ideas. Welded joints will create maximum stability in mechanical and fire-resistant aspects. An unlimited choice of decorative upholstery is offered.
V) Combination or complete replacement of wood with chipboard is considered a budget option for making a frame. You shouldn't expect such furniture to last very long. Covering it with sealed paint will help eliminate the increased concentration of evaporating resins in the air used in the production of wood-chip products.
- Multilayer filling provides softness, elasticity and good performance parameters to the sofa. The internal filling consists of a shock-absorbing part and materials that give softness and elasticity to the sofa.

2.1. Springs
a) Bonnell metal blocks are spiral-shaped conical columns intertwined with each other. They can withstand a lot of weight, let air through, but can creak and will only last for 7-10 years. At the same time, a person lying down does not get enough comfort, because the load from the body is distributed unevenly across the surface.
b) Independent springs placed in spunbond are distinguished by smooth spirals. They do not creak, unlike their predecessors, and work only in the direction of the load that locally affects each spring in its own way. The sleeping person receives an orthopedic effect and sufficient comfort after rest. Service life is from 10 years.
2.2 Polyurethane foam. It is produced in slab form. Block products are produced by gluing several sheets together by thickness. Cast material is produced under pressure in a mold. A hard layer forms on its surface, which negatively affects air and moisture transfer. The thicker the filler, the longer it will last.
2.3 Sintepon serves as both a filler and a heat-saving layer. It does not withstand regular increased loads, collapsing in thickness.
2.4 Sintepuh - is a polyester fleece covered with silicone. Soft and fluffy, it creates internal volume in pillows and armrests.
2.5 Durafil is of synthetic origin. Vertically oriented fibers help maintain the original shape and volume. Bacteria do not settle in the material.
2.6 Foam rubber is considered a hopeless material with a short service life. Piece filling quickly fails, and the sheet analogue is often used in combination with other internal materials.
2.7 Hollowfiber created by processing synthetic fibers. Capable of restoring its shape after the load disappears, due to the increased degree of pore formation it is a good heat-saving component.
2.8 Rubber latex is a very reliable and expensive material. Cylindrical cells are hygroscopic and allow air to pass through perfectly.
- Decorative finishing material is selected depending on the frequency of use of sofas. The most practical material is leatherette or eco-leather. A good choice is arpatek, which is resistant to sunlight. Flock, velvet, chenille and jacquard are more suitable for a private home than for an office.

The color issue also has its own peculiarities. Black is convenient for infrequent cleaning, but in small offices it will look a little gloomy. A special dark gray will add sophistication, dark brown - luxury, burgundy - imposingness. Bright shades will look good in companies whose activities are related to creativity. Light colors get dirty quickly, so they are used either in executive offices or in places of rare use.
Decorative material should not cause dissonance with the finished interior.
